Output e268d76f0039cd24739affd2cde7b03dbf17876fd0a40e0a8d6bdf9a8577c516:1

value
74297
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 305130104085f47923776b3eb4a41eb62e1243cf14dc526726f302ece14dfdc4
address
bc1pxpgnqyzqsh68jgmhdvltffq7kchpys70znw9yeex7vpwec2dlhzqh60hde
transaction
e268d76f0039cd24739affd2cde7b03dbf17876fd0a40e0a8d6bdf9a8577c516
confirmations
45712
spent
true